Guess who’s strutting back into the limelight with more than just new tunes? It’s none other than the Hip-Pop sensation, Lil Nas X!

In a move that’s got us all raising an eyebrow in anticipation (and maybe a dance move or two), the maestro has spilled the beans about his upcoming documentary special, aptly titled ‘Long Live Montero.’ Move over, Netflix and chill – we’re all about HBO and Max for this one.

Scheduled to drop on January 27, this special isn’t just your run-of-the-mill documentary. Oh no, buckle up for a wild ride as Lil Nas X takes us on a rollercoaster of epic proportions during his ‘Long Live Montero Tour.’ And in case you’re wondering, that’s 60 days of pure, unadulterated Nas magic.

Having made its debut at the Toronto Film Festival, this docu-film promises to spill the tea on the highs, lows, and glittery moments of Nas’ career, all while he struts his stuff on the ‘Long Live Montero Tour.’ Think of it as a personal diary entry, but with more swag and a killer soundtrack.

Our main man, Nas (or as his mom probably calls him, Montero Hill), will be sharing his thoughts on being a Black queer performer in the Pop universe. It’s like getting a backstage pass to the mind of the man who made ‘Montero’ a household name in 2021.

So, mark your calendars for January 27 at 8 pm ET, HBO – and if you’re feeling a bit more modern, Max has your streaming needs covered.
